DefaultRemoteSettingsFilterProvider Třída
Definice
Důležité
Některé informace platí pro předběžně vydaný produkt, který se může zásadně změnit, než ho výrobce nebo autor vydá. Microsoft neposkytuje žádné záruky, výslovné ani předpokládané, týkající se zde uváděných informací.
Implementace některých výchozích filtrů vzdálených nastavení, které by měly být schopny využívat všechny aplikace.
public ref class DefaultRemoteSettingsFilterProvider : Microsoft::VisualStudio::RemoteSettings::RemoteSettingsFilterProvider
public class DefaultRemoteSettingsFilterProvider : Microsoft.VisualStudio.RemoteSettings.RemoteSettingsFilterProvider
type DefaultRemoteSettingsFilterProvider = class
inherit RemoteSettingsFilterProvider
Public Class DefaultRemoteSettingsFilterProvider
Inherits RemoteSettingsFilterProvider
- Dědičnost
Konstruktory
DefaultRemoteSettingsFilterProvider(TelemetrySession) |
Vytvoření výchozího zprostředkovatele filtru vzdáleného nastavení z předaného v TelemetrySession |
Metody
GetAppIdPackageGuid() |
Guid balíčku AppId (specifický pro VS – prázdný řetězec, pokud není k dispozici) (Zděděno od RemoteSettingsFilterProvider) |
GetApplicationName() |
Název aplikace, která používá službu vzdáleného nastavení. |
GetApplicationVersion() |
Verze aplikace, která používá službu vzdáleného nastavení. |
GetBranchBuildFrom() |
Větev aplikace (specifická pro VS – prázdný řetězec, pokud se nedá použít). (Zděděno od RemoteSettingsFilterProvider) |
GetChannelId() |
ID instalačního kanálu. (Zděděno od RemoteSettingsFilterProvider) |
GetChannelManifestId() |
ID manifestu instalačního kanálu. (Zděděno od RemoteSettingsFilterProvider) |
GetClientSourceType() |
Produkt, ve který se klient používá |
GetClientSourceType() |
Produkt, ve který se klient používá (Zděděno od RemoteSettingsFilterProvider) |
GetClrVersion() |
Verze používaného modulu CLR |
GetCulture() |
Řetězec jazykové verze aplikace. |
GetCurrentPolicy() |
Místní zásady pro telemetrii |
GetCurrentPolicy() |
Místní zásady pro telemetrii (Zděděno od RemoteSettingsFilterProvider) |
GetGroupPolicy() |
Zásady skupiny pro telemetrii |
GetGroupPolicy() |
Zásady skupiny pro telemetrii (Zděděno od RemoteSettingsFilterProvider) |
GetIsUserInternal() |
Zda je uživatel interním microsoftem |
GetLimitDumpCollection() |
Zásady shromažďování výpisů paměti |
GetLimitDumpCollection() |
Zásady shromažďování výpisů paměti (Zděděno od RemoteSettingsFilterProvider) |
GetMacAddressHash() |
MacAddressHash |
GetMachineId() |
Id počítače |
GetManifestId() |
ID manifestu instalace. (Zděděno od RemoteSettingsFilterProvider) |
GetMSPFlags() |
Získání aktuálního nastavení příznaku MSP |
GetMSPFlags() |
Získání aktuálního nastavení příznaku MSP (Zděděno od RemoteSettingsFilterProvider) |
GetNotificationsCount() |
Počet odeslaných oznámení (Zděděno od RemoteSettingsFilterProvider) |
GetOsType() |
Typ operačního systému. V současné době pouze "Windows" |
GetOsVersion() |
Aktuální verze operačního systému |
GetProcessArchitecture() |
Hodnota architektury procesu |
GetProcessArchitecture() |
Hodnota architektury procesu (Zděděno od RemoteSettingsFilterProvider) |
GetSessionRole() |
Role relace, klient nebo server |
GetUserId() |
UserId |
GetVsIdAsync() |
VSid přihlášeného uživatele (specifický pro VS – prázdný identifikátor GUID, pokud není k dispozici). (Zděděno od RemoteSettingsFilterProvider) |
GetVsSku() |
Skladová položka aplikace (specifická pro VS – prázdný řetězec, pokud není k dispozici). (Zděděno od RemoteSettingsFilterProvider) |